Factors Influencing Market Rent

Nashville House

Property Size and Amenities:

The size of your rental property and the amenities it offers play a massive role in determining fair market rent. Larger properties or those with sought-after amenities, such as in-unit laundry or plentiful parking, can typically justify higher rental prices. When drafting the listing description for your property, make sure to highlight all of the relevant amenities. Anything you can do to make your rental stand out is a plus.

Property Condition:

Well-maintained properties with modern upgrades and a fresh appearance will generally command higher rental prices. Investing in proactive maintenance and improvements can certainly provide a positive impact on the perceived value and justify higher rates. It is wise to ensure that your property does not look neglected, as you are leaving money on the table by doing so. Simple upgrades like a fresh coat of paint and new carpet can go a long way. 

Comparable Property Analysis:

Conducting a thorough analysis of the surrounding properties in the area is a cornerstone of our pricing strategy. We utilize technology in order to gain an accurate understanding of what comparable properties in the area are renting for. This involves researching properties similar in size, amenities, and condition to gauge the competitive landscape. 

Local Economics:

Monitoring local economic indicators, such as job growth, unemployment rates, and changes in population, provides valuable insights into the financial health of the market and potential tenants. Having a deep understanding of the current economy is crucial when adjusting pricing strategies to reflect the current market. 


Setting the Right Price for Profitability

Profitability

Balancing Competitiveness and Profitability:

While it is vital to stay competitive in the market, it is equally important to remain profitable. Setting the rent too low may secure a tenant much more quickly, but you're sacrificing profitability. If you set the rent too high, you may make more money, but your rental may sit vacant for much longer. You are losing money with each day that your property is vacant. Striking the right balance here is key. 

Regular Rent Reviews:

In Nashville, the rental market is quite dynamic. Yesterday's price is not today's price. Fair rental prices today will likely need to be re-evaluated in the near future. Regularly reviewing and adjusting rent prices based on the current market conditions is key in remaining competitive and maximizing profitability.
